Polk County’s girls tennis team again used a full-roster approach in posting a 9-0 sweep Thursday of Patton in Morganton.

The Wolverines are now 3-0, 2-0 in Mountain Foothills 7 Conference play. Patton dropped to 0-4, 0-2.

Polk County dominated the match, sweeping through singles play with a total loss of four games. The Wolverines then rotated in several new players for doubles and also swept through those matches.

Polk returns to action on Tuesday, traveling to East Rutherford for another conference match.
